WOMEN'S SOCCER DROPS A-10 OPENER TO SAINT JOSEPH'S

9.29.03 | Women's Soccer

PHILADELPHIA -- The Temple women's soccer team (2-6-1, 0-1 A-10) lost, 2-0, to crosstown rival Saint Joseph's (3-3-1, 1-0 A-10) on Monday, September 29 at Temple Stadium. The game marked the Atlantic 10 Conference season opener for both teams.

Saint Joseph's jumped on the board early in the first half as senior Michelle Ford fed the ball to freshman Megan Schutt, who drilled it into the net, for the first score of the game. With fifteen minutes remaining in the second half, freshman Kaiti McCaffery found Schutt near cage. Schutt accepted McCaffery's pass and knocked it across the goal line for the score.

Sophomore Trish Dalton led the offensive effort with two of the team's six shots, both coming on goal. Defensively, freshman Elizabeth Tarasevich stepped into cage as the starting goalkeeper, replacing the team's normal starter, junior Jackie Mauro, who was out with an injury. Tarasevich registered three saves for the Owls.

Saint Joseph's goalkeeper Nicole DiEnna recorded three saves in the shutout victory.

The Owls play their second Atlantic 10 Conference game on Friday, October 3 at 7:30 p.m. at Dayton.
